Chimney Built Over The Sistine Chapel

VATICAN CITY - APRIL 15: A worker puts the chimney on the top of the Sistine chapel on April 15, 2005 in Vatican City. Since 1878, white smoke from the Sistine Chapel chimney signaled a new pope was chosen, and black would mean that deliberations continued. The conclave begins on April 18, 2005, John Paul II's successor will be announced traditionally with smoke from the chimney on thr Sistine Chapel and the riniging of the bells of St. Peter's Basilica.
